I just upgraded NoScript 2.9.5.1 from NoScript 2.9.0.14 and discovered that the (Mac OS X 10.6.7) Firefox (48.0.2) Addons option to "Get add-ons" hangs Firefox. It's supposed to bring up a page that starts with "Personalize your Firefox". The only way out of this is to force quit Firefox and relaunch.

After a bit of experimentation I discovered that I could get "Get add-ons" to work if I set NoScript's XSS advanced option check box for "Sanitize cross-site suspicious requests" off. Previously it was on and that still works with 2.9.0.14.

There could be a possibility that 2.9.5.1 is interacting with one of my other 38 addons since I cannot reproduce the problem with a clean profile. However, that interaction would have to have been introduced by 2.9.5.1 since using 2.9.0.14 in the same full profile does not have the Get add-ons problem when the only addon changed/updated is NoScript. So I have to blame NoScript for introducing the possible interaction.

At the moment I am getting around the problem by keeping the Sanitize option off. But I prefer to keep it on as it has always been in the past. Of course I could just elect to keep it on. I did finally reproduce the problem in a clean profile after going through the elimination process trying to find out which of my other addons might be interacting with NoScript in a copy of my full profile. It appears to be Custom Buttons (CB).

I figured that maybe one of my many custom buttons might be the culprit since I couldn't reproduce the problem in a clean profile with only NoScript and CB because in that case there are no custom buttons defined. So I took my CB data base (the custombuttons directory within my full profile) and moved it into the clean profile. Thus I had a clean profile with only NoScript 2.9.5.1 and CB installed along with my full collection of custom buttons. Thus at this point all the buttons can be seen in the customize window because none of them have been placed on tool bars in the clean profile setup.

The "hang" reproduced in the clean profile with just NoScript 2.9.5.1 and CB and my full set of custom buttons. It is strange since none of the custom buttons are actually installed on tool bars so I would think none of their code should be executed. At any rate I went on the "hunt" deleting my custom buttons in this clean profile. The "hang" continued to reproduce but eventually I saw the Get Addons appear after a long delay.

On a hunch I deleted more of the buttons (remember none of them are actually active -- you can only see them in customize) and sure enough the Get Addons page started to appear when I clicked it with a shorter and shorter delay as I deleted more and more buttons. Just to check out that the "hang" was only a long delay I put back my full set of custom buttons (simply copy the custombuttons directory again from my full profile back into the clean profile I'm testing with). With the full set of my custom buttons I clicked the Get Addons and just left it alone. I didn't time it but I think the "hang" took over an hour to come up on my 3.33 GHz machine. But the point is the Get Addons page did show up.

It looks to me that the length of the hang may be exponentially long as a function of the number of custom buttons I have defined. I really don't understand why an otherwise passive data base of button definitions (some of which are bookmarklets) should have any affect on NoScript, let alone its XSS sanitize option. Weird.
